铀冶炼厂附近水稻白菜茶柑桔食用部分中U 226Ra Th和Mn2+ Cd Cr Pb的浓度

Contents of Several Metals in Edible Parts of Selected Crops Grown in an Areanear a Uranium Smelter

【摘要】 对某铀冶炼厂附近生长的水稻、白菜、茶、柑桔食用部分以及这些植物生长区土壤中的放射性污染物U、226Ra、Th和非放射性污染物Mn2+、Cd、Cr、Pb的浓度进行了测定,并计算了相应的污染物生态转移参数(Bv值)。结果表明,稻米、白菜、桔子以及土壤中Cd的浓度超出标准,其余污染物的浓度没有超标;茶叶对污染物的Bv值相对较高,桔子对污染物的Bv值相对较低。

【Abstract】 This study was conducted to determine concentrations of uranium, radium, thorium and manganese, cadmium, chromium, lead in edible parts of rice (Oryza sativa), Chinese cabbage (Brassica pekinensis), tea (Camellia sinensis) and orange (Citrus reticulate) grown in an area as well as soil samples collected near a uranium smelter. In the same time, the ecologic transfer parameter (Bv value) of those pollutants was computed. The results showed that the concentrations of cadmium in rice, vegetable and orange also in soil exceeded the official standard. The Bv value of tea-leaf representing an absorbing capacity for pollutants was bigger than that of others; while Bv value of oranges was the least.
